Transaction 8665d47cb0fd87da71ea04dde959e94db163140aef416685ee7244322fe4fe5d
1 Input
1 Output
-
8665d47cb0fd87da71ea04dde959e94db163140aef416685ee7244322fe4fe5d:0
- value
- 304606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ba2e3932ab5763a8d19115c6e7a01b0548ab4d21 OP_EQUAL
- address
- 3JfSytFLwJXHKAtinYkwkx4s3YUZLFcgVo